VIKINGS FALL TO STATE POWER

PLAY-OFF EXPERIENCE...is what Sam Smallwood and the Miami East Vikings came away with against traditional state power, Marion Local.

Story by Dwayne Maxson
The Vikings' season came to an end Friday night against Marion Local as they lost 37-0 in the first round of the Division V state playoffs.

Offensively they struggled all night and only managed around 130 yards of total offense. Not even Sam Smallwood could get far as he only managed about 30 yards rushing on the night.

Although they managed to make some plays defensively, they could not stop Flyer quarterback Chris Stucke and the rest of the Flyer offense. Stucke completed 10 of 17 passes for 160 yards and 3 touchdowns. He also returned an interception for touchdown.

"We played well in spots and not so well at other times," said Viking Coach Max Current. "Our boys came in believing in themselves when no one gave them a chance. They played hard like they were going to win. We just made too many mistakes and could not get anything going offensively. Marion Local was just as good as I thought they were. I thought we did make enough plays to make them earn it. Their offense really did not have any real big plays against us. They just kept going at us and getting first downs and got some scores. Our boys learned a lot and hopefully the underclassmen will come back next season and be ready to accomplish even more. I would like to say thank you to our fans as they showed great support tonight."

Miami East finishes the season 8-3 overall and 8-1 in the Cross County Conference.

Marion Local with the win improved to 11-0 overall and will play Cincinnati Deer Park next week.
